Really need help on getting into software development after gate by Alternative_Ad4603 in developersIndia

[–]sridharmb 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Official documentation pages & youtube videos. It's hard first month, but becomes so much easier later. I had to consciously not fall into the trap of tutorial hell, so started working on few simple ideas to build whole system.

Html, css -> few videos on youtube. Mern stack -> coding addict youtube channel.

Python & fastApi & postgres->free code camp.

Watched videos to understand fundamentals and behaviour of launguages and modules, then tried coding my own ideas, though small. It Worked out very well.

What really helped me in great deal was before starting to learn cosing, I didn't know where to learn or what to learn, so I watched a whole 20 hrs video of data structures that explained everything about arrays, lists, objects, hashtable, linkedlist etc and their operations. so It helped me visualize better.

It’s so damn hard to promote your startup for free by Kooky_Wolverine_7915 in SaaS

[–]sridharmb 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Tell your story in a way that audience feel it deserved their time. There are two step processes, Do not promote what you are building, instead tell them why you are building, and how does it help users from your perspective. General users on social media doesn't care about jargons like SaaS, tech etc, they care only about your purpose (which you can use it to build a bit of brand for yourself) and how does whatever you are building helps them or provide new experience. So, have a strategy, tell you story of resolve, purpose and why you decided to build it and then give them glimpses or snippets of how it could provide new experience. Use canva to make your content bit attractive, ensure there is uniformity or unique signature in your posts, color styles, and designs. Remember, it never about the content of the story anymore, it is about the emotions story emulates, people generally appreciate genuine hardworking founders be it solo or gang . So, bottom line, forget what, Scream why and Show how!
